secondary address on BVI - 1310 ios 12.3(4)JA

petesa
Level 1
Level 1

int BVI1

ip address 10.0.1.1 255.255.255.0

ip address 10.1.1.1 255.255.255.0 secondary

Need the radio int on a different network from the ethernet int. Planned on using a secondary address on the BVI int.

I've had no luck adding a secondary address to the int BVI1. CLI accepts the string, but the entry is never added to the config. Anyone with ideas about what I'm missing?

Try this - it seems to create a second instance of the BVI 1 interface.

ap#conf t

Enter configuration commands, one per line. End with CNTL/Z.

ap(config)#int bvI 1:0

ap(config-if)#

ap(config-if)#ip address 10.2.2.2 255.255.255.0

ap(config-if)#end

ap#sh ip int brief

Interface IP-Address OK? Method Status Protocol

BVI1 192.168.54.1 YES NVRAM up up

BVI1 10.2.2.2 YES manual up up

both addresses can be pinged
